Information on Power Co., is shown below. The company's tax rate is 38 percent.

Debt: 8,800 8.1 percent coupon bonds outstanding, $1,000 par value, 22 years to maturity, selling for 103.5 percent of par; the bonds make semiannual payments

Common stock: 213,000 shares outstanding, selling for $83.30 per share; beta is 1.18.  

Preferred stock: 12,300 shares of 5.9 percent preferred stock outstanding, currently selling for $97.70 per share.

Market: 7.15 percent market risk premium and 4.95 percent risk-free rate.

What is the the company's WACC?
